Thinking about giving your Gold Coast home a facelift? Whether it’s a modern kitchen, a breezy outdoor entertaining area, or a complete home transformation, renovating can significantly improve your lifestyle and add value to your property. But before you jump in, it’s important to understand the process and unique considerations that come with renovating in the Gold Coast.
The first step in any successful renovation is careful project planning. This involves clearly defining your goals, setting a realistic budget, and creating a detailed timeline. What do you want to achieve with your renovation? Are you looking to increase space, improve functionality, or simply update the aesthetics? Once you have a clear vision, you can start researching design ideas and gathering inspiration. Consider your lifestyle and how you want to use the renovated space. Think about the flow of the house and how the new renovation will integrate with the existing structure. Don’t forget to factor in potential challenges, such as council approvals or unexpected structural issues.
Finding the right local contractors is crucial for a smooth and successful renovation. The Gold Coast has a wide range of builders, plumbers, electricians, and other tradespeople. It’s essential to do your research and choose contractors who are licensed, insured, and have a proven track record of quality workmanship. Ask for recommendations from friends, family, or neighbors. Check online reviews and testimonials to get a sense of their reputation. Get multiple quotes from different contractors and compare their prices, services, and timelines. Don’t be afraid to ask questions and clarify any doubts before signing a contract. A good contractor will be transparent, communicative, and willing to work with you to achieve your vision.
There are several things to consider when renovating on the Gold Coast. The local climate plays a significant role in design choices and material selection. The Gold Coast experiences hot, humid summers and mild, sunny winters. This means you need to choose materials that are durable, weather-resistant, and suitable for the coastal environment. Consider using materials that are resistant to moisture, salt air, and UV damage. Good ventilation is also essential to prevent mold and mildew growth. Think about incorporating features that maximize natural light and airflow, such as large windows, skylights, and louvers.
The Gold Coast is known for its relaxed, outdoor lifestyle. Many homes feature large balconies, patios, and swimming pools. When renovating, consider how you can enhance your outdoor living spaces to take advantage of the beautiful weather. Create a comfortable and inviting outdoor entertaining area with comfortable seating, a barbecue, and a dining table. Add shade structures, such as pergolas or awnings, to protect you from the sun. Consider landscaping to create a lush and tropical oasis. A well-designed outdoor space can significantly enhance your lifestyle and add value to your property.
The culture of the Gold Coast is laid-back and informal. This is reflected in the architecture and design of many homes. Coastal style is a popular choice, with its light, airy spaces, natural materials, and relaxed vibe. Consider incorporating elements of coastal style into your renovation, such as white walls, timber floors, and natural textures. Use light and bright colors to create a sense of spaciousness and openness. Add pops of color with artwork, cushions, and accessories. Don’t be afraid to experiment with different styles and create a space that reflects your personality and taste.

Before starting any renovation project, it’s also wise to check with the Gold Coast City Council regarding any necessary permits or approvals. Depending on the scope of your renovation, you may need to obtain building permits or other approvals. It’s important to comply with all local regulations to avoid any potential problems down the road. Your contractor should be able to advise you on the necessary permits and assist you with the application process.
